Title:

Procedures and Limits Regarding the Determination of the Separation Efficiency of Particle Precipitators for Small Scale Biomass Furnaces

Author(s):

Ulbricht, T., von Sonntag, J.

Document(s):

Paper Paper

Abstract:

While combustion of biomass is a climate­friendly means to keep a house warm, emissions have to be considered. With the improvements shown by e.g. Diesel particle filters, particulate matter emissions (PME) of small scale solid biofuel furnaces has come into the focus of public attention. Particle precipitators are an obvious remedy. In order to foster the installation of these devices, standards have to be agreed on regarding their evaluation. The legal background, a proposal for a test bed design, uncertainty budgets and a preliminary evaluation of particle counting vs. gravimetric determination are presented as part of the road to establishing standard precipitator evaluation procedures. The operational map of a commercial electrostatic precipitator including different fuels and different volume flow rates is shown alongside a possible explanation of its behavior.
